.@CEOofHMCTS we are extremely concerned that the Court has taken over 12 months so far to deal with an application we made in October 2021. The application has not yet been issued and we do not yet have a hearing date.

The Divorce, Dissolution & Separation Act 2022, comes into force from 6 April. It's the biggest reform of #divorcelaw in 50 years & will help couples split with less conflict thanks to the inclusion of the ‘no fault’ option. Our team fully support the changes #nofaultdivorce
